Output 0863062a6e30ce43342e3cfa8481812dcec4a12781c043246cd22dbe89cb422b:4

value
31034573
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b644fe73e97d351054cb25b2ffc4abd3b75b299e OP_EQUAL
address
MQWus8LxnjRD6pREyxZyaFRcGK8bsQNuCe
transaction
0863062a6e30ce43342e3cfa8481812dcec4a12781c043246cd22dbe89cb422b
spent
true